In June 2026, Simon Perdue Law, PLLC proudly acknowledges National Safety Month, an initiative spearheaded annually by the National Safety Council. This observance is essential in raising awareness about preventable injuries and deaths, aiming to promote safety education across various platforms—be it in workplaces, on roads, or within communities.
The campaign for this year centers around critical themes aimed at addressing safety concerns. Week by week, the initiative covers significant topics like roadway safety, workplace hazard reduction, employee engagement, and strategies to prevent injuries. Numerous organizations throughout Texas, notably chapters of the Associated General Contractors (AGC) and local safety councils, continue to bolster these efforts by providing specialized training programs, safety stand-downs, and educational events dedicated to minimizing high-energy hazards and workplace accidents.
